Burnout in Project Management

The IIL Blog

Stress and burnout have been recognized as serious project management problems for years, but until recently companies have been reluctant to face the problems head on. Some project managers thrive on stress and seem to avoid burnout. There is risk that burnout can spread to the entire team if not identified and controlled.

Product Discovery Anti-Patterns Leading to Failure

Scrum.org

Scrum has proven to be an effective product delivery framework for all sorts of products. However, Scrum is equally well suited to build the wrong product efficiently as its Achilles heel has always been the product discovery part. How that is supposed to happen is nowhere described in the Scrum Guide.
